66 | =head1 NAME |
67 | |
68 | componentui_server.pl - Catalyst Testserver |
69 | |
70 | =head1 SYNOPSIS |
71 | |
72 | componentui_server.pl [options] |
73 | |
74 | Options: |
75 | -d -debug force debug mode |
76 | -f -fork handle each request in a new process |
77 | (defaults to false) |
78 | -? -help display this help and exits |
79 | -host host (defaults to all) |
80 | -p -port port (defaults to 3000) |
81 | -k -keepalive enable keep-alive connections |
82 | -r -restart restart when files get modified |
83 | (defaults to false) |
84 | -rd -restartdelay delay between file checks |
85 | -rr -restartregex regex match files that trigger |
86 | a restart when modified |
87 | (defaults to '\.yml$|\.yaml$|\.pm$') |
88 | -restartdirectory the directory to search for |
89 | modified files |
90 | (defaults to '../') |
91 | |
92 | See also: |
93 | perldoc Catalyst::Manual |
94 | perldoc Catalyst::Manual::Intro |
95 | |
96 | =head1 DESCRIPTION |
97 | |
98 | Run a Catalyst Testserver for this application. |
